A number of foreign cycling teams are likely to take part in Lahore to Sahiwal International Cycle race to be held on March 23 as a part of Pakistan Day celebrations. “Invitations have been extended to India, Bangladesh, Syria and Afghanistan and we will be bearing the entire expense of the foreign teams by sending them air tickets and providing boarding and lodging facilities,” said Idris Haider Khawaja, secretary general of his own faction of the Pakistan Cycling Federation (PCF) here on Friday. “The 154-kilometre long event will be participated by the provincial teams and the affiliated units of the PCF,” he added. He said each foreign team could field two riders and one official in the race that would further boost the efforts of promoting cycling in the country. “Punjab Chief Minister Mian Mohammad Shahbaz Sharif will be the chief guest at the prize distribution ceremony and the winner will get a cash award of Rs 100,000,” he said.
